A Keevaris Enterprise Partner is not just a large client. It is an operator who is an active part of the product process.

Strategic access
A direct channel, no intermediaries
Direct access to the product and engineering team, with a dedicated strategic contact and a direct escalation path. No generic support layers.
Roadmap
A real voice in product decisions
You participate in product discovery. You can propose and discuss strategic requirements, with priority consideration for recurring needs in your operation.
Early Access
First to test new features
Early access to selected modules, preview environments and AI capabilities before general release, with structured feedback loops.
Co-innovation
We test together before scaling
Pilots at a single site or country level, running in parallel with your current system, with defined acceptance criteria before deciding on a wider rollout.
Governance
A periodic review, not a vague promise
Quarterly product session (roadmap, adoption, feedback, integrations) and annual strategic review (technology, expansion, new markets).
Migration & integration
From your current stack to the Keevaris core
Assessment of your current system, data mapping, phased migration and API-first architecture to integrate what you already use.

Migration & integration

From your current stack, no leap into the unknown.

The transition is not all-or-nothing. Keevaris integrates with what already works and replaces what does not, at your pace.

Phased migration
We assess your current system, map the data and migrate in phases: run in parallel with your current system, validate, and cut over once proven. Country by country if your operation requires it.
Open integration architecture
API-first from the core. We connect with what you already use: payments, access control, accounting, identity. If something isn't supported yet, we assess it as part of the process.

To be clear

One platform. Not a different version per client.

Keevaris is built around recurring industry patterns and real operator feedback. An Enterprise Partner helps identify, validate and prioritise those patterns, without creating a customer-specific fork of the product.

Doesn't include
  • Bespoke software development
  • Ownership of the product roadmap
  • A separate product version per client
Does include
  • Configuration to how you work
  • Integration with your current stack
  • Extension on the same shared core

Configure. Integrate. Extend. Don't fork.
